Maison  >  Article  >  développement back-end  >  Étapes pour mettre en œuvre le développement du compte public WeChat à l'aide de PHP

Étapes pour mettre en œuvre le développement du compte public WeChat à l'aide de PHP

WBOY
WBOYoriginal
2023-06-27 12:26:451298parcourir

Comment utiliser PHP pour développer des comptes publics WeChat

Les comptes publics WeChat sont devenus un canal important de promotion et d'interaction pour de nombreuses entreprises, et PHP, en tant que langage Web couramment utilisé, peut également être utilisé pour le développement du compte public WeChat. Cet article présentera les étapes spécifiques pour utiliser PHP pour développer des comptes publics WeChat.

Première étape : Obtenir le compte développeur du compte officiel WeChat

Avant de commencer le développement du compte officiel WeChat, vous devez demander un compte développeur du compte officiel WeChat compte. Le processus d'inscription spécifique est disponible sur le site officiel de la plateforme publique WeChat.

Après l'inscription, vous pouvez obtenir votre AppID et AppSecret dans le Developer Center. Ces deux paramètres seront utilisés dans le processus de développement ultérieur.

Étape 2 : Configurer le serveur du compte public WeChat

Le serveur du compte public WeChat doit recevoir les messages et événements poussés par le serveur WeChat via Webhook, et PHP peut être créé par Un serveur remplit cette fonction.

Avant de configurer le serveur, vous devez préparer un serveur exécutant PHP et installer les dépendances nécessaires. Les dépendances courantes incluent :

  • Pdo ou Mysqli
  • Base de données MySQL
  • Curl ; Bibliothèque d'analyse XML
  • Bibliothèque de décryptage Mcrypt.
  • Après avoir installé les dépendances, vous pouvez configurer le serveur du compte officiel WeChat en suivant les étapes suivantes :

Configurer dans le centre de développement de l'adresse du serveur du compte officiel WeChat et définissez le jeton (une chaîne aléatoire).
  1. Créez une interface Webhook pour recevoir les messages et événements poussés par le serveur WeChat. L'interface peut être implémentée à l'aide du propre serveur HTTP de PHP ou d'autres serveurs Web (tels qu'Apache ou Nginx).
  2. Ajoutez une logique métier à l'interface pour traiter les messages et les événements poussés par le serveur WeChat. Pour une implémentation spécifique de la logique métier, veuillez vous référer à la documentation de développement du compte officiel WeChat.
  3. Étape 3 : Implémenter les fonctions du compte public WeChat

Après avoir terminé la configuration du serveur, vous pouvez commencer à implémenter les fonctions spécifiques du compte public WeChat . En PHP, ces fonctions peuvent être implémentées en appelant l'API fournie par le compte officiel WeChat. Les API couramment utilisées incluent :

Envoyer des messages ordinaires : vous pouvez utiliser du texte, des images, de la musique, des vidéos et d'autres formulaires
  • Obtenir des informations sur l'utilisateur : vous pouvez obtenir utilisateurs Informations de base, tags, fans, etc. ;
  • Créer un menu : vous pouvez créer un menu personnalisé pour faciliter l'utilisation de l'utilisateur
  • Générer un code QR : vous pouvez générer différents types ; de codes QR pour réaliser différentes fonctions.
  • De plus, davantage de fonctions peuvent être obtenues en intégrant le compte officiel WeChat à d'autres systèmes. Par exemple, vous pouvez intégrer votre compte officiel WeChat à votre propre base de données pour obtenir des services plus personnalisés.

Résumé

Ce qui précède sont les étapes de base pour utiliser PHP pour développer des comptes publics WeChat. Il convient de noter que le développement d'un compte public WeChat nécessite certaines connaissances de base en PHP et une certaine expérience en programmation, il nécessite donc une certaine quantité de temps et d'énergie pour l'apprendre. Dans le même temps, afin de garantir la qualité et la sécurité des comptes publics WeChat, il est recommandé d'effectuer certains tests et contrôles de sécurité avant le développement.

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!

Déclaration:
Le contenu de cet article est volontairement contribué par les internautes et les droits d'auteur appartiennent à l'auteur original. Ce site n'assume aucune responsabilité légale correspondante. Si vous trouvez un contenu suspecté de plagiat ou de contrefaçon, veuillez contacter admin@php.cn